#c358ea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c358ea is composed of 76.5% red, 34.5%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.7%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 284 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 63.1%. #c358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ff with #8700d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

● #c358ea color description : Soft violet.
#c358ea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c358ea has RGB values of R:195, G:88,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 12802282.

Shades and Tints of #c358ea
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060107 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c358ea
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a0a2 is the less saturated color, while #ca4af8 is the most saturated one.
